A Ghost in the Deep

The Virginia-class isn’t just another submarine; it’s engineered to be virtually invisible. With advanced stealth technology, it moves silently through the water, evading sonar and remaining undetectable to enemy forces. From the surface, there’s no trace; from below, it’s a ghost that can strike without warning.

Over 8 million kilograms of reinforced steel form its hull, capable of withstanding the immense pressures of the deep sea. Inside, a nuclear reactor powers the submarine for decades without refueling, giving it unmatched endurance for long-term deployments.

Technology Ahead of Its Time

The Virginia-class incorporates decades of cutting-edge military research. Its propulsion system is whisper-quiet, its sonar systems advanced enough to map and track targets miles away, and its combat systems integrated to respond instantaneously to threats. Every aspect of the submarine has been designed to give the U.S. Navy a decisive advantage in underwater warfare.
